mirror of
https://github.com/outbackdingo/cozystack.git
synced 2026-01-27 18:18:41 +00:00
This patch removes the loophole to leave resource requests and limits unspecified in managed apps. Any of cpu, memory, and ephemeral storage are now filled in from the resource preset (default or user-specified) if not explicitly specified in .Values.resources. "none" is no longer an accepted value in resourcePresets and the primary resources now always have some explicit value for proper billing and isolation. Signed-off-by: Timofei Larkin <lllamnyp@gmail.com>
Managed RabbitMQ Service
RabbitMQ is a robust message broker that plays a crucial role in modern distributed systems. Our Managed RabbitMQ Service simplifies the deployment and management of RabbitMQ clusters, ensuring reliability and scalability for your messaging needs.
Deployment Details
The service utilizes official RabbitMQ operator. This ensures the reliability and seamless operation of your RabbitMQ instances.
- Github: https://github.com/rabbitmq/cluster-operator/
- Docs: https://www.rabbitmq.com/kubernetes/operator/operator-overview.html
Parameters
Common parameters
| Name | Description | Value |
|---|---|---|
external |
Enable external access from outside the cluster | false |
size |
Persistent Volume size | 10Gi |
replicas |
Number of RabbitMQ replicas | 3 |
storageClass |
StorageClass used to store the data | "" |
Configuration parameters
| Name | Description | Value |
|---|---|---|
users |
Users configuration | {} |
vhosts |
Virtual Hosts configuration | {} |
resources |
Resources | {} |
resourcesPreset |
Use a common resources preset when resources is not set explicitly. (allowed values: none, nano, micro, small, medium, large, xlarge, 2xlarge) |
nano |